#d58272 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d58272 is composed of 83.5% red, 51% green and 44.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 39% magenta, 46.5%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 9.7 degrees, a saturation of 54.1% and a lightness of 64.1%. #d58272 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ffe4 with #ab0500.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

● #d58272 color description : Slightly desaturated red.
#d58272 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d58272 has RGB values of R:213, G:130, B:114 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.39, Y:0.46,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 13992562.
